TEACHING EXPERIENCE

I started teaching special education English in 2011 at a high school in Baltimore County. Recently I moved up to central Pennsylvania where I continue to teach a combination of self-contained/adaptive English classes as well as co-taught inclusion classes. I have a dual graduate degree in special education and secondary education and am certified in both special education and English 7-12.

MY TEACHING STYLE

I've spent the majority of my career teaching in self-contained special education settings and co-teaching in standard classes. My products are made to reach all learners; not through watering down the content, but through the presentation of the information. Vocabulary worksheets include visuals because most students benefit from the addition of appropriate and meaningful visual aids. My graphic organizers are made to chunk information in ways that help struggling students better understand the material. I love teaching special education and adore the students I work with. My passion is connecting with students who struggle in “standard” classrooms because they tend to learn differently from what we consider to be the average student.
